Dogs Everywhere In Mourning

From the News Tribune:


A tractor trailer carrying 42,000 lbs. of dog food overturned Thursday about 1:50 p.m. on Route B near St. Thomas.

Chris Champlain, 33 Henley, was driving the truck from the Diamond Dog Food factory in Meta. According to the Missouri State Highway Patrol, the accident occurred when Champlain crossed the centerline, overcorrected, and ran off the right side of the highway before overturning.


I hate to think of the clean-up. Maybe they could just invite the townspeople to bring their dogs down for a potluck supper.
